🔍 Understanding VTU SGPA: Complete Guide

What is SGPA?

SGPA (Semester Grade Point Average) is a measure of academic performance for a specific semester in VTU (Visvesvaraya Technological University). It represents the weighted average of grade points earned in all subjects during a semester, considering the credit value of each subject.

🧮 How VTU SGPA is Calculated

The SGPA calculation follows a credit-weighted system where each subject’s grade point is multiplied by its credit value. The formula is:

SGPA = Σ(Credit × Grade Point) / Σ(Total Credits)

Step-by-Step Calculation Example:

Let’s say you have 5 subjects with the following marks and credits:

  • Mathematics (4 credits): 85 marks → Grade A (9 points)
  • Physics (3 credits): 92 marks → Grade S (10 points)
  • Chemistry (3 credits): 78 marks → Grade B (8 points)
  • Programming (3 credits): 88 marks → Grade A (9 points)
  • Workshop (2 credits): 95 marks → Grade S (10 points)

Calculation:

Total Grade Points = (4×9) + (3×10) + (3×8) + (3×9) + (2×10) = 36 + 30 + 24 + 27 + 20 = 137

Total Credits = 4 + 3 + 3 + 3 + 2 = 15

SGPA = 137 ÷ 15 = 9.13

📊 VTU Grade to Mark Conversion Chart

Grade S

90-100 marks

10 Points

Grade A

80-89 marks

9 Points

Grade B

70-79 marks

8 Points

Grade C

60-69 marks

7 Points

Grade D

50-59 marks

6 Points

Grade E

45-49 marks

5 Points

Grade F

0-44 marks

0 Points

🎯 Importance of SGPA in Academic Progression

SGPA plays a crucial role in your academic journey at VTU:

  • Academic Standing: Determines if you’re eligible to progress to the next semester
  • Scholarship Eligibility: Many scholarships require minimum SGPA criteria
  • Placement Opportunities: Companies often set SGPA cutoffs for campus recruitment
  • Higher Studies: Graduate programs consider SGPA for admission
  • Academic Recognition: High SGPA leads to academic honors and awards

🧑‍🎓 SGPA vs CGPA: Key Differences

SGPA (Semester Grade Point Average):

  • Calculated for individual semesters
  • Reflects performance in current semester only
  • Used for semester-wise evaluation
  • Range: 0.00 to 10.00

CGPA (Cumulative Grade Point Average):

  • Calculated across all completed semesters
  • Reflects overall academic performance
  • Used for final degree classification
  • More important for placements and higher studies

💬 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What happens if I fail in one subject?
If you score below 45 marks (Grade F) in any subject, you get 0 grade points for that subject. This significantly impacts your SGPA. You’ll need to appear for supplementary exams to clear the subject.
Q: Is SGPA rounded off in VTU?
Yes, VTU typically rounds SGPA to two decimal places. However, for internal calculations and comparisons, the exact value is often considered.
Q: How many credits are there per subject in VTU?
Credit distribution varies by subject type: Theory subjects usually have 3-4 credits, Practical/Lab subjects have 1-2 credits, and Project work can have 2-6 credits depending on the semester and branch.
Q: What’s a good SGPA in VTU?
SGPA above 8.5 is considered excellent, 7.0-8.5 is good, 6.0-7.0 is average, and below 6.0 needs improvement. However, this can vary based on the branch and semester difficulty.
Q: Can I improve my SGPA in subsequent semesters?
While you cannot change a semester’s SGPA once declared, you can improve your overall CGPA by performing better in subsequent semesters. Focus on consistent improvement across all semesters.
Q: Do internal marks affect SGPA calculation?
Yes, internal assessment marks (usually 20-30% of total marks) are included in the final marks used for SGPA calculation. This includes assignments, tests, attendance, and practical performance.
